Output 7666e5508feae04b23762d394daffbdbfa39aa123e08b8f26bb5cc443a88da47:60

value
102955
script pubkey
OP_0 OP_PUSHBYTES_32 70d3e2071a35810aaeac7223331961652b7f9b37450d7c54c2a412bd966397d5
address
bc1qwrf7ypc6xkqs4t4vwg3nxxtpv54hlxehg5xhc4xz5sftm9nrjl2syghg5l
transaction
7666e5508feae04b23762d394daffbdbfa39aa123e08b8f26bb5cc443a88da47